Biscotti Cake Bulk Flower: Signature Blend of Hybrid Aromas
The Biscotti Cake bulk flower combines the best indica and sativa genetics for relaxation and alert focus. This makes it perfect for those wishing to relax while keeping a clear head. The strain comes from Biscotti and Wedding Cake, two strains that produce dense buds with a sweetness not too dissimilar from a dessert hit.
What separates Biscotti Cake from other hybrids is its structure. The buds are dense and full of resin, with stickiness that signals quality trichome production. For bulk shoppers, this consistency is crucial. Every batch has high cannabinoid content and is tested equally!

Terpene Profile: The Science of Flavor
Terpenes are what give each and every great strain its character, and Biscotti Cake is no different! The peppery warmth you taste at the back of your throat comes from caryophyllene.
The citrusy lift that adds a little lightness to this flavor comes courtesy of limonene, which also has anti-anxiety properties. And lastly, myrcene darkens down that earthy bottom note and brings in the relaxation vibes. Combined, they make for a tasty and mighty soft strain.
Biscotti Cake is an excellent choice for growers who use these terpenes for extraction. The oil retains a rich, robust flavor even after processing, resulting in a full-bodied product.

Growing Traits: Dense, Generously Resinous Buds
Biscotti Cake is a heavy-yielding strain that benefits from regular attention. It forms ultra-dense and rock-hard buds with explosive trichomes, a sign of a successful resin producer. The size remains manageable, even for growers who are limited on space.
The flowering phase for Biscotti Cake takes 8-9 weeks, with a final yield that’s more than impressive, befitting of the strain’s high cannabinoid content. When cured properly, the buds completely excel in terms of smell and texture, especially if you store them properly.

What to Look for When Buying Biscotti Cake Bulk Flower
When buying Biscotti Cake Bulk Flower, you want to ensure the quality is top-notch. Check density, trichome coverage, and aroma as well. Biscotti Cake Flowers have a sugar-coated look and dense bud structure, and that bakery scent should hit you as soon as you open a fresh batch. You don’t want to buy overly dry batches, as they lose most of their terpenes and potency.

Most bulk buyers prefer vacuum-sealed or humidity-controlled packaging, which helps preserve the aroma and stability of cannabinoids. Since their terpenes are volatile, storing them properly ensures they retain their expected profile.
To preserve the strain’s integrity for long-term storage or commercial sales, refrigeration in clear jars that light cannot easily penetrate is recommended. A reputable Biscotti Cake Bulk flower supplier should also ensure batch consistency, lab-verified potency, and terpene content.
